Buyers Products Fender Hanger Bracket works with fender mounting arms to attach fenders to your vehicle. They are available as a pair or sold individually.

Specifications

Color Black
Finish Plain
For Use With 8591010 / 8591020 / 8591000 / 8591001
Height (in.) 2.50 (3.75 at tallest part)
Length (in.) 12.00
Material Polyethylene
Required For Use With 8591010 / 8591020
Width (in.) 2.00

Advanced Material Science: The Polyethylene Advantage

The selection of polyethylene as the primary material for these fender hanger brackets is a deliberate engineering choice, reflecting a commitment to superior performance and durability in demanding operational environments. Polyethylene, particularly high-density polyethylene (HDPE) or a similar industrial-grade variant, offers a spectrum of advantages over traditional metallic materials in this specific application.

  • Exceptional Durability and Longevity: Polyethylene exhibits remarkable resistance to impact, abrasion, and fatigue. Unlike metals that can deform or fracture under repetitive stress or sudden impacts from road debris, polyethylene possesses inherent elasticity and toughness, absorbing energy and mitigating damage. This translates to an extended operational lifespan for the brackets, reducing the frequency and cost of replacements.
  • Superior Corrosion Resistance: One of the most significant benefits of polyethylene is its complete immunity to rust and chemical corrosion. Metallic brackets are highly susceptible to degradation from moisture, road salts, de-icing chemicals, oils, fuels, and industrial solvents, leading to structural weakening and premature failure. Polyethylene remains inert to these corrosive agents, ensuring consistent structural integrity throughout its service life, regardless of environmental exposure.
  • Significant Weight Reduction: Polyethylene components are substantially lighter than their steel or aluminum counterparts. This weight saving, while seemingly minor for a single pair of brackets, contributes to an overall reduction in vehicle mass, which can cumulatively enhance fuel efficiency, increase payload capacity, and reduce tire wear, offering substantial long-term operational cost savings for fleet operators.
  • Vibration Dampening Characteristics: The viscoelastic properties of polyethylene allow it to effectively absorb and dampen vibrations transmitted from the road or engine. This dampening effect not only contributes to a quieter ride but, more importantly, reduces vibrational stress on the fender, mounting arms, and the vehicle's frame, thereby extending the lifespan of interconnected components and minimizing the risk of fatigue-related failures.
  • UV Stability and Environmental Resilience: While the finish is described as "Plain," industrial-grade polyethylenes used in outdoor applications are typically compounded with UV stabilizers. This ensures that the material resists degradation from prolonged exposure to solar radiation, preventing embrittlement, cracking, or color fading over time. Furthermore, polyethylene maintains its mechanical properties across a broad temperature range, performing reliably in extreme hot and cold climates without becoming brittle or excessively flexible.
  • Thermal Expansion Compatibility: In environments with significant temperature fluctuations, metallic components can undergo considerable thermal expansion and contraction. When paired with plastic fenders, this differential expansion can lead to stress points and premature fatigue. Polyethylene's thermal expansion coefficient is more closely aligned with many plastic fender materials, promoting greater compatibility and reducing thermal stress within the fender assembly.

In direct comparison to steel, polyethylene eliminates the need for complex coatings or galvanic protection, simplifies manufacturing, and reduces environmental impact during production. Against aluminum, it offers better impact absorption and superior resistance to certain chemical agents, all while being more cost-effective. Installation Protocol and Best Practices

While designed for straightforward integration, proper installation of the Replacement Pair Fender Hanger Brackets is essential to realize their full performance potential and ensure the longevity of the entire fender system. The installation process typically involves several key considerations:

  • Secure Frame Attachment: The brackets must be securely fastened to a robust part of the vehicle's chassis or frame. This often involves drilling, though pre-existing mounting points are ideal for replacement installations. The use of appropriate grade hardware (bolts, nuts, washers) that resists corrosion and vibration is crucial. Fasteners should be torqued to manufacturer specifications to prevent loosening under dynamic road conditions.
  • Alignment and Clearance: Precise alignment of the hanger brackets and subsequently the fender mounting arms is paramount. Proper alignment ensures even weight distribution, prevents the fender from rubbing against tires or other vehicle components, and maintains aesthetic symmetry. Adequate clearance must be maintained between the fender and tires to accommodate suspension travel and tire chain usage if applicable.
